Section 750-080-0040 - Civil Penalty Schedule

Universal Citation: OR Admin Rules 750-080-0040

Current through Register Vol. 63, No. 3, March 1, 2024

(1) The State Board of Towing adopts the following Schedule of Civil Penalties:

(a) 1st offense: $0 - $500

(b) 2nd offense: $500 - $1000

(c) 3rd offense: $1000 - $2500

(d) Additional offenses: Additional civil penalties, in an amount up to $25,000 per violation, as determined by the Board.

(2) The Board may assess a civil penalty in an amount greater than the Schedule of Civil Penalty when it is determined by the Board that a particular violation or conduct is especially egregious or severe causing unnecessary risk or harm to the public and others.

(3) In determining an appropriate civil penalty amount, the Board may consider the following:

(a) The severity of the violation or its impact on the safety or wellbeing of the public;

(b) The number of similar or related violations;

(c) Whether a violation was willful or intentional;

(d) The prior history of civil penalties and sanctions imposed by the Board or other regulatory agencies

(e) Other circumstances determined by the Board to be applicable to the violation(s).

Statutory/Other Authority: ORS 822.265, ORS 822.995

Statutes/Other Implemented: ORS 822.265, ORS 822.995
